    View attachment 3199669 View attachment 3199670 View attachment 3199671 Hi Tom, I hope i am not to late with a suggestion, but I have owned a 47 KB2 Panel for 35 years, It is powered by a 302 Ford with a C4 trans and Ford 9" rear axle out of a 1980 F100 pick-up. I towed my stockcar with it for 20 years and the set-up was bullet proof. The front suspension is out of a mid 80's Aerostar Van. It is the correct width suspension wise and bolts to a 4X4 steel box bolted to each side of the frame to increase the frame width. A mustang 2 front suspension cannot support these trucks properly because of the weight...my truck weighs 6000 pounds.You can install your own choice of drivetrain of course, but to me, unless your frame is completely rotted away, you cannot outdo stock fit of a stock frame SDC11987.JPG DSC00542.JPG DSC00544.JPG
